die from
Frequency: 8.520.1 per million words
Used to indicate the immediate cause of death, often an external one like injuries.

Examples (10)
- The accident victim died from her injuries before help could arrive.
- Tragically, the patient died from complications following the surgery.
- Many soldiers in ancient wars died from infected wounds rather than the initial injury.
- The coroner's report confirmed he died from severe head trauma.
- It is feared that the missing climber may have died from exposure to the extreme cold.
- Without proper treatment, a person can die from dehydration in a matter of days.
- The documentary showed how many animals die from ingesting plastic waste.
- She almost died from blood loss after the attack.
- He survived the crash, only to die from an unexpected secondary infection.
- Statistics show a decrease in the number of people who die from work-related accidents.
